Paper Recycling - The Environmental & Money Saving Benefits

Saturday, February 20th, 2010

The environment benefits greatly from paper being recycled and, fortunately, it is not at all difficult to do. Once it has been collected (by either your local authority or a recycling company acting on their behalf), it is taken to a paper mill, who take care of the rest of the recycling process.

The first thing that happens at the paper mill is the turning of the scrap paper into pulp. Having been turned into pulp, it is then cleaned and de-inked. It is then ready to be made into new products such as newspapers, toilet rolls and other paper based items commonly found in the home and office.

So, now that you know how simple the recycling process for paper is, lets look at benefits that it brings…

Saves Trees - The most obvious reason to recycle paper is for saving trees which provide vital oxygen for the planet. Just 1 ton of recycled paper saves at least 16 of them.

Wildlife Preservation - Recycling paper helps protect the habitats of beautiful birds, insects and a wide variety of wildlife that lives in those trees.

Saves Space - We need to save as much space as possible in landfill sites to prevent more having to be created, and 3 cubic yards can be saved per ton of recycled paper.

Less Pollution - Paper can burn in municipal waste incinerators that can spew out all kinds of air pollutants. When many incinerators are in urban locations, everyone would benefit from breathing better air if there were fewer of them.

Creates Jobs - Recycling paper is good for communities. Someone has to actually do all that recycling which means more jobs are created. With the global recession in full swing this is a welcome side effect of recycling paper.

Sets A Precedent - Paper is probably the easiest thing to recycle, so it is a good starting point for those who do not currently recycle at all. Having gotten into the habit of recycling paper, and seeing that it really is not difficult, people are more likely to start recycling other items too.

Cheaper Paper - Recycled paper is often cheap to purchase. Buying cheaper, recycled goods encourages more recycled goods to be manufactured, sustaining the recycling industry.

There’s No Excuse For Not Recycling Aluminum And Steel Cans

Thursday, February 11th, 2010

Every year thousands upon thousands of tons of trash is poured into landfills. Though we are in no danger of running short on landfill space, this is expensive in terms of time, space, and energy invested, as well as the sheer waste of materials that will not be used again. With that in mind, consider these reasons to keep your aluminum and steel cans out of landfill sites by recycling them.

1. Aluminum that has been recycled is back in use again within 2 months. On the other hand, it would take 200-500 years for that metal to break down naturally if were just thrown away.

2. Recycled aluminum and steel are no different in composition from ‘new’ aluminum and steel. Recycled metals are simply melted down and then forged into new products, which can then be recycled again when they are finished being used.

3. Metal cans can be exchanged for cash at many places. Various states offer five cents for each can given to them, and some recycling centers offer between a dollar and two dollars per pound of cans recycled.

4. Recycling is not just about material savings, but also about energy consciousness. Each aluminum can recycled saves enough energy to run a television for 3 hours.

5. The 100,000,000 ‘new’ steel cans produced every day contain 25% recycled materials. That is the equivalent of 25 million reclaimed cans vs. 75 million completely new cans. If more people recycled, that number would soon become 50-50 and a great deal of energy and resources would be saved.

6. There are multiple can-crushing machines available that can be used to make the job easier, including some that can be made at home for almost no cost. This removes the a commonly used excuse that recycling cans takes up too much space within your home.

How To Divide Garbage To Minimize The Landfill

Saturday, January 16th, 2010

In most communities, reducing, reusing, and recycling waste has become a standard practice to minimize the amount of garbage going into landfills. Sorting your waste will often depend on the recycling program in your community. Most have guidelines published for residents. There are general guidelines, though.

Sorting garbage can reduce the impact on landfill by about 75%. The first step is to separate the organic/food waste from all the other garbage. That means anything that has grown; vegetable matter, meat, yard waste, tea bags, coffee grounds, eggshells and table scraps. These materials are all compostable, and many communities use the compost for plants and trees by roadsides and in town gardens, and sometimes sell the compost to home gardeners. It is also possible to compost in your own backyard. Compost bins are easy to construct, and once you have good compost up and running, it practically takes care of itself.

The next category of garbage is the bottles, tin foil and cans. This might include juice and milk cartons, plastic bags, bubble wrap, rigid plastic packaging. These items should be rinsed before sorting. They can all be diverted from landfill and sent for recycling. Old tires and building materials can also be diverted from landfill for recycling. Recycling equipment is used to help process these materials. Some of the products being made from these recyclables are floor tiles, road surfaces, sandals, swings, carpeting, plastic furniture and many other imaginative and creative products.

Paper and cardboard is the other broad category. This would include cardboard boxes that food such as cereal comes in. It would also include newspapers, letters and envelopes, toilet paper rolls, and any other dry clean paper product. Boxes should be flattened to minimize the bulk and making the pick-up more efficient. Paper and paper products are recycled into paper and paper products. There is an increasing demand for recycled paper from consumers and companies. The process is kinder to the environment, and calls for fewer trees to be felled for paper. Landfills are filling up across the continent. By removing those items that can be recycled - paper, cardboard, glass, wood, organic matter - we reduce the impact on landfill sites. We also minimize the impact of landfill seepage into the water table. Making our garbage as small as possible reduces our imprint on the planet, and extends the life and health of our landfills.

When organic matter ends up in a landfill, the normal breakdown into nutrients does not occur, because the fill is packed so tightly that air does not circulate around the decaying matter. Rather than return nutrients to the earth, organic matter under those conditions produces methane, which contributes to global warming. Landfills become clogged with items that will never degrade, such as plastics. In the manufacturing process, petroleum, the primary element of plastics, is altered so that it is not recognized by the bacteria and enzymes that break down matter to its reusable form. Removing these products from landfill and sending them off to be reused is a more efficient way of handling the resources that are in limited supply. There are other products that may degrade naturally if exposed to sunlight, but that also is unlikely in a heavily packed landfill. Again, removing those items from that stream, and sending them to new uses through recycling saves energy, resources and the health of the planet.

Advantage Of Renewable Energy

Saturday, November 7th, 2009

The world presently has an even bigger growth rate in its demand for energy. This is due mainly to the rapid increase of population, which has more than two times in the last 50 years. This has caused a injury on our energy supply, which has brought about an increase in energy prices and shortages in a lot of parts of the globe. Conventional energy supplies like petroleum and gas are said to have been declining drastically and has the possibility of running out completely in the future. This has influenced many individuals to look for alternative energy sources one of which is renewable energy. The concept of renewable energy is not new.

individuals have been using every advantage of renewable energy for thousands of years for various uses. Some utilize it for heating and cooking while others use it for lighting their houses. There are those who utilize it transport their vehicles and operate their machines. This renewable energy comes in a lot of types the common ones being solar, water, wind, biomass and geothermal energy. Today, with the present situation regarding conventional energy resources like fossil fuel, people have been searching for means to use this power to give electricity and power to their homes.

The main benefit of renewable energy over fossil fuels is the reality that it is renewable. This means that it may easily be refilled without so much effort for man. This is for the reason that this energy is produced through natural processes so they are normally found in nature. These makes them virtually infinite in amount and so are not in risk of running out. Additionally, this energy can’t be quickly consumed because it just goes back to nature where it was harnessed.

Because of the fact that they are sourced from nature, renewable energy is additionally clean and does not normally give harmful effects when harnessed and used.

This benefit of renewable energy is very vital especially today where a lot of the environmental pollution comes from power plants and factories that are used to provide electricity. By using renewable energy, this pollution can be greatly lessened and even avoided in the future.
